Collectible Motorcar of Atlanta is proud to offer this very rare
1932 Ford Roadster. The 1932 Ford was offered in a 201 cu 4
cylinder or the more desirable 221 cu in Flathead V8 Model 18.
Replacing the Model A; the new Ford not only got the new V8 option,
but was on a longer wheelbase, got a lower hood line and a new
chassis. These cars are known to be much more comfortable than its
precursor, and has a much sleeker look. These days, the Roadster is
a very popular car amongst people wanting to build a street rod and
making an old classic into a restomod.
This Roadster in particular is very genuinely done, with a slick
black paint job over a beautiful red interior and a tan soft top.
This is a full Brookfield steel body car, and has no fiberglass
components. Power comes from A 221ci Flathead V8 with earlier
generation center port 59A Offenhauser finned aluminum 24-stud
heads and an Offenhauser dual carb aluminum intake fitted with Ford
59 carburetors and Edmonds oval aluminum air cleaners.
Inside the cockpit, you will see the full array of Ford gauges,
turn signals, black steering wheel, and carpeted floor mats. All
new 12-volt wiring with new fuse panel were installed in the
process. On the ground are Ford chrome wheels/hubcaps wrapped in
Firestone. The results are quite striking! Its full combination of
all-Ford components provides for a truly traditional street rod
that will speak to the hearts of the classic 1950's era of early
